02 Apr 2025

Oakes Energy Services

OAKES ENERGY SERVICES LTD Stand: 177
Oakes Energy Services

Oakes designs, installs and maintains all types of HVAC and renewable technology to support long-term sustainability and reduce business overheads.

Loading